Nepal Crush West Indies by 90 Runs: The Nepal cricket team created history on Monday by defeating two-time T20 World Cup champions West Indies by 90 runs. With this victory, Nepal took an unassailable 2-0 lead in the three-match T20 series and won a T20 series against an ICC Full Member team for the first time. This match was the second T20 match between Nepal and West Indies, and Nepal created a record by registering its second consecutive win.
Now, the two teams will face each other in the third and final T20 on Tuesday, where Nepal will aim for a clean sweep. This victory for Nepal is the biggest victory of an Associate team against a Full Member team by run margin. Previously, Nepal had created history by winning the first T20 match by 19 runs.

Nepal, batting first, posted a strong total of 173/6. Two of the team's young batsmen, Asif Sheikh and Sundeep Zora, scored brilliant half-centuries. Sheikh scored an unbeaten 68 off 47 balls, while Zora smashed 63 off 39 balls, including five sixes. The two shared a 100-run partnership, which helped Nepal post a big total.

Chasing the target, the West Indies were completely bowled out for just 83 runs in 17.1 overs. Nepal's medium-pacer Mohammad Adil Alam produced a career-best performance, taking four wickets for 24 runs. This is the West Indies' lowest T20I total against an Associate team, falling even further behind England's 88 against the Netherlands in the 2014 T20 World Cup.

The West Indies batting was a complete failure. Only three batsmen reached double figures. Jason Holder top-scored with 21 runs. Team captain Akeal Hossain said after the match, "We need to quickly understand that this is international cricket. If we can't prove ourselves at this level, we should question ourselves whether we are truly international players."

Nepal captain Rohit Paudel said after the historic victory, "This is a proud moment for us. Defeating a Test-playing nation wasn't easy. This series was extremely important for us to show the world how far Nepal cricket has come. Our goal now is to achieve a clean sweep in the series."
